5.2.1 Grade 1 guards have hot stick handles attached for installation. 5.2.2 Grade 2 guards are equipped with eyes for installation with removable hot sticks. 5.2.3 Grade 3 guards are intended for applications where the usual installation is by hand. These guards are equipped with rope loops, or their equivalent, so their removal may be accomplished with hot sticks. 5.2.3.1 Example Pole guards installed on a pole prior to raising it close to overhead line conductors. After the pole is raised the guard is opened with hot sticks and allowed to slide down the pole where it can be safely removed by hand. 17

Insulating Gloves High dielectric and physical strength, flexibility and durability Manufactured by dipping porcelain form into a tank of liquefied rubber Process is repeated until the required thickness is reached All gloves are electrically tested following the requirements of ASTM D120/IEC 903 19
Insulating Gloves Gloves are available in six classes - Class 00 through Class 4 - Class 00 and Class 0 gloves are available in Type I natural rubber non-resistant to ozone Type II - SALCOR resistant to ozone Class 0 and 00 gloves are available in 11 and 14 inch length 20
Insulating Gloves Class 1 through 4 gloves are available in - Yellow, red or black - Contrasting two-color combination Makes inspection for cuts and tears easier - Class 1 through 4 gloves are available in 14,16 and 18 inch length 21
Insulating Gloves Cuff design - Straight cuff is standard on 14, 16 and 18 gloves - Contour cuff is available for 18 gloves - Bell and flair cuffs are available on 14, 16 and 18 gloves Straight Contour Bell 22

Insulating Sleeves Extend coverage of the arm from the cuff of rubber insulating glove to the shoulder Folded cuff fits into the glove easier without pushing Manufactured by dipping and molding method Meet requirements of ASTM D1051 100% electrically tested 28
Insulating Dipped Sleeves Same dipping process as in gloves manufacturing Available in the same colors and color combinations as gloves Available in the styles - Straight - Extra curved Available in classes - 0,1,2,3 and 4 Type I natural rubber only 29
Insulating Molded Sleeves Manufactured by either injection or compression methods Available in Type I and Type II material Available in - Class 1,2,3 and 4 Available in curved arm style only 30
